Bi-directional optical flow method with simplified gradient derivation
A video coding device may be configured to perform directional Bi-directional optical flow (BDOF) refinement on a coding unit (CU). The device may determine the direction in which to perform directional BDOF refinement. The device may calculate the vertical direction gradient difference and the horizontal direction gradient difference for the CU. The vertical direction gradient difference may indicate the difference between the vertical gradients for a first reference picture and the vertical gradients for a second reference picture. The horizontal direction gradient difference may indicate the difference between the horizontal gradients for the first reference picture and the horizontal gradients for the second reference picture. The video coding device may determine the direction in which to perform directional BDOF refinement based on the vertical direction gradient difference and the horizontal direction gradient difference. The video coding device may perform directional BDOF refinement in the determined direction.
AUTOMATIC CONTROL AND ENHANCEMENT OF 4D ULTRASOUND IMAGES
A method includes emitting an ultrasound beam, having a predefined field of view (FOV), from an array of ultrasound transducers in a catheter in an organ of a patient. Echo signals are received in the array, in response to the ultrasound beam. A position of a target object is estimated within the FOV. When the estimated position of the target object violates a centering condition, the FOV of the ultrasound beam is automatically modified to re-meet the centering condition.
Calibration of detection system to vehicle using a mirror
The disclosure provides for a method of calibrating a detection system that is mounted on a vehicle. The method includes detecting characteristics of the mirror and characteristics of a vehicle portion using the detection system. The mirror reflects the vehicle portion to be detected using the detection system. The method also includes determining a first transform based on the detected one or more of mirror characteristics, determining a second transform based on the one or more vehicle portion characteristics, and determining a third transform based on a known position of the vehicle portion in relation to the vehicle. Further, the method includes determining a position of the detection system relative to the vehicle based on the first, second, and third transforms and then calibrating the detection system using the determined position of the detection system relative to the vehicle.

SYSTEMS AND METHODS FOR SYNCHRONIZING AN IMAGE SENSOR
Systems and methods for synchronization are provided. In some aspects, a method for synchronizing an image sensor is provided. The method includes receiving image data captured using an image sensor that is moving along a pathway, and assembling an image sensor trajectory using the image data. The method also includes receiving position data acquired along the pathway using a position sensor, wherein timestamps for the image data and position data are asynchronous, and assembling a position sensor trajectory using the position data. The method further includes generating a spatial transformation that aligns the image sensor trajectory and position sensor trajectory, and synchronizing the image sensor based on the spatial transformation.

Identification of orientation of implanted lead
An example method includes obtaining an image of a lead implanted in a patient, the lead including one or more electrodes positioned along a longitudinal axis of the lead and a plurality of orientation markers; determining, in the image, respective locations of the electrodes and respective locations of the orientation markers; obtaining a template model corresponding to the lead; determining a transform between the determined locations of the one or more electrodes and the plurality of orientation markers and locations of corresponding electrodes and orientation markers in the template model; and determining the rotational orientation of the lead based on the transform.
Detecting motion in images
In general, the subject matter described in this disclosure can be embodied in methods, systems, and program products for detecting motion in images. A computing system receives first and second images that were captured by a camera. The computing system generates, using the images, a mathematical transformation that indicates movement of the camera from the first image to the second image. The computing system generates, using the first image and the mathematical transformation, a modified version of the first image that presents the scene that was captured by the first image from a position of the camera when the second image was captured. The computing system determines a portion of the first image or second image at which a position of an object in the scene moved, by comparing the modified version of the first image to the second image.
